Higher education as a determinant of sustainable development

Abstract
The purpose of the article is to study higher education using a systemic approach as a determinant of sustainable development. To achieve the goal, the scientists substantiated the main features of higher education as a system; identified the main priority directions in the field of higher education in a time frame; outlined the functions of education in the modern development of society; highlighted the role and principles of higher education in economic growth; substantiated the relationship and development trends of higher education with the goals of sustainable development in the direction of solving global problems of humanity. The methodological basis of this study is a systematic approach, which allows us to consider higher education as an open social system with multi-vector and heterogeneous connections between elements, which has an interdependent impact on sustainable development. Taking into account changes in trends and priorities of the world economy, changes in the emphasis of higher education are highlighted. It has been studied that higher education ensures the development of the intellectual potential of the human community, contributes to the achievement of the goals of sustainable development and the consolidation of certain moral principles.
